Which word is more common?

Sociable is more commonly used in everyday language than extroverted. While extroverted is more commonly used in psychology and personality studies.

What’s the difference in the tone of formality between extroverted and sociable?

Both extroverted and sociable are relatively neutral in terms of formality. However, extroverted may be more commonly used in academic or professional settings, while sociable is more commonly used in informal settings.
